Colin Short

not sure about top ten but Sting in “Radio Bart”….

Marge Simpson: Sting, you really should rest. You’ll wear yourself out.
Sting: Not while one of my fans needs me!
Marge Simpson: Actually, I’ve never heard Bart listen to one of your albums…
Homer: Shh, Marge! He’s a good digger!

February 23, 2012 on The Simpsons’ 10 Greatest Rock Moments